Despite Costs, A College Degree Is Still Worth It

To economists who look at the numbers, college is a necessary, even if not sufficient, ticket to the middle class. "We are experiencing a period of shared misery, where workers at all education levels are struggling, including those with a college degree," says Lawrence Mishel, president of the Economic Policy Institute, a left-leaning Washington think tank. Still, he says, "It is certainly evident that those with college educations are faring much better than those with less education."
